Questions tagged [dc-dc-converter]
DC-DC conversion. Implies conversion of a DC voltage level up or down. DC-DC converter can be isolated or non-isolated. Electronically it can be done by many kinds of circuits, depending upon the application (charge pumps, voltage multipliers, linear voltage regulators, boost/buck switched converters, etc)
